Venezuelan man detained 5 months, released with urgent deadline to return to Utah
Jul 19, 2026 · Utah, Venezuela

Maikol, a 22-year-old Venezuelan national, was detained in Utah and held in immigration custody for five months. He was transferred through multiple detention centers across the country and housed at Desert View Annex in Adelanto, California, where he says conditions were inhumane. He was recently released with conditions requiring him to return to Utah by a specific deadline to maintain his release status.
